0tokens

Topic / open source programming logic games for india classrooms

Open Source Programming Logic Games for India Classrooms

Unlock the potential of young minds with open source programming logic games tailored for India’s classrooms. These games not only captivate students but also enhance their logical reasoning and coding skills.


In recent years, the education landscape in India has seen a significant shift towards integrating technology into teaching methods. Open source programming logic games have emerged as a popular tool for teaching programming concepts in a fun and interactive way. These games not only enhance students' critical thinking and problem-solving abilities but also encourage collaboration and creativity. With an emphasis on accessibility, this article explores various open source programming logic games suitable for Indian classrooms and their impact on learning.

The Importance of Logic Games in Education

Logic games are structured puzzles and challenges that encourage users to develop systematic problem-solving techniques. Some benefits include:

  • Enhanced Critical Thinking: Students learn to analyze problems and evaluate solutions.
  • Collaboration: Many games promote teamwork, helping students build communication skills.
  • Engagement: Interactive platforms keep students motivated and focused on learning.
  • Application of Knowledge: Games allow students to apply programming concepts in real-world scenarios.

What Makes a Game Open Source?

Open source games offer several advantages:

  • Customizability: Teachers can modify the games to better fit their lesson plans and student needs.
  • Zero Cost: These games are free to use, making them accessible to schools with limited budgets.
  • Community Support: Open source projects often have robust online communities that contribute to the improvement and expansion of the game.

Top Open Source Programming Logic Games for Indian Classrooms

Here are some worthy open source programming logic games that can be implemented in Indian classrooms:

1. Scratch

Scratch is a free programming language developed by MIT that helps students create their own interactive stories, games, and animations. Its block-based interface makes coding intuitive and fun.

  • Age Group: 8 to 16 years.
  • Benefits: Encourages collaboration, enhances problem-solving skills, and boosts creativity.

2. CodeCombat

CodeCombat is a platform that gamifies learning programming through real coding tasks. Students type real code to control their characters in an exciting fantasy setting.

  • Age Group: 9 years and older.
  • Languages Supported: Python, JavaScript.
  • Benefits: Helps students learn by doing, fostering a hands-on understanding of programming fundamentals.

3. Robocode

Robocode is a competitive games-based platform where students code robot tanks to battle with each other. It focuses on Java programming and enhances logical thinking.

  • Age Group: 12 years and older.
  • Benefits: Teaches object-oriented programming and encourages strategic thinking.

4. Blockly Games

Blockly Games are a series of educational games that teach programming concepts while ensuring that students enjoy solving puzzles.

  • Age Group: 8 to 16 years.
  • Benefits: Simple, visual programming helps students understand the logic without being overwhelmed.

5. Tynker

Tynker provides various game-like activities to master coding skills. It allows students to create their own games while learning programming languages such as JavaScript, Python, and more.

  • Age Group: 7 years and older.
  • Benefits: Tailored projects align with students' interests, fostering a love for coding.

Integrating Logic Games into the Classroom

To effectively implement these open-source programming logic games in classrooms, teachers can follow these strategies:

  • Curriculum Mapping: Align games with curriculum objectives to ensure they enhance learning outcomes.
  • Collaborative Projects: Encourage group work to solve problems, fostering teamwork.
  • Feedback and Reflection: After gaming sessions, hold discussions to allow students to reflect on their learning experiences.
  • External Collaborations: Partner with local tech firms or educational organizations to bring in resources or mentorship.

Conclusion

Open source programming logic games are more than just fun activities; they are powerful tools that can reshape the way programming is taught in Indian classrooms. By incorporating these games into teaching practices, educators can enhance engagement, foster creativity, and equip students with essential skills needed in today's digital world.

FAQ

Q1: Are these games suitable for all age groups?
A1: Most games are designed for specific age ranges, from 7 to 16 years, catering to different learning levels.

Q2: Can these games be modified for different learning styles?
A2: Yes, being open source allows educators to customize games to suit various learning preferences and needs.

Q3: Are these games available offline?
A3: While some games require internet access, many are available as downloadable versions for offline play.

Q4: How can I introduce these games in my classroom?
A4: Start with a pilot program, introduce a select few games aligned with your curriculum, and assess student engagement and learning improvements.

Apply for AI Grants India

If you're an AI founder looking for support to enhance education through innovative technologies, consider applying for grants at AI Grants India. Empower the future of learning today!

Building in AI? Start free.

AIGI funds Indian teams shipping AI products with credits across compute, models, and tooling.

Apply for AIGI →